Staying Clear Of Costly Errors and Delays



Reliable project administration pivots on careful preparation and the adept mitigation of mistakes and troubles in construction operations - RainierGPR Service Areas. Preventing pricey blunders and hold-ups is extremely important for the effective conclusion of any project when it comes to concrete scanning. By utilizing innovative scanning technologies such as ground-penetrating radar (GPR) and electromagnetic induction, building teams can recognize potential risks beneath the surface before excavation begins, avoiding expensive damages to energy lines, structures, or various other essential framework


Moreover, accurate scanning assists in avoiding hold-ups brought on by unexpected explorations during construction. Unforeseen obstacles can dramatically hinder progress, bring about budget overruns and timeline extensions. By performing complete scans and analyzing the collected data effectively, project supervisors can proactively check these guys out attend to any type of issues prior to they rise, making certain a smoother building process. Furthermore, preventing rework due to mistakes in underground formats or missed out on utilities can conserve both time and money, improving general project performance. Consequently, focusing on detailed concrete scanning not only decreases risks however also advertises cost-effectiveness and timely job delivery.

Improving Job Efficiency



RainierGPR Service AreasRainierGPR Service Areas
With the execution of modern-day innovations such as concrete scanning, construction tasks can dramatically improve their operational efficiency. By utilizing concrete scanning devices, job supervisors can enhance numerous elements of the construction process, leading to enhanced task efficiency. One key advantage of concrete scanning is the capacity to determine prospective Check Out Your URL risks, such as rebar or post-tension cords concealed within concrete structures, permitting aggressive decision-making to stop pricey hold-ups or mishaps.


Furthermore, concrete scanning makes it possible for construction teams to accurately locate energies, minimizing the danger of harmful underground pipelines or electrical lines throughout excavation work. This accuracy not only conserves time but also minimizes the requirement for costly repairs and revamp. In addition, by having a clear understanding of the subsurface conditions, task timelines can be better intended and followed, leading to smoother project execution.
